My wife and I took "meals on wheels" to over 100 fireant mounds yesterday. I had two big containers of the white powder fireant bait. One is a Bayer product and the other is called "Surrender" with acephate as an active ingredient. They both stink to high heaven and you only have to use a teaspoonful per small mound to "do the deed." I have another can and will make a follow-up sweep today to see how successful we were. It was just warm enough that the ants were very active and came swarming up for the banquet when the powder was sprinkled on the mounds.
